The Junee property market recorded a median price of $249,500 for houses in the 2nd half of 2017, signifying 6.4% annual growth. This suggests real capital growth as over the same period of time (2nd half 2016 - 2nd Half 2017) the number of house sales also increased, by 5.9%. Junee Shire LGA recorded a median price of $250,000 in 2nd half 2017, which represents a 9.2% annual growth. Overall this presents Junee as a more affordable option in the Riverina area and in comparison to Metro areas in NSW, but with strong positive growth.
